HARARE – MDC Alliance Vice Chairperson, Job Sikhala who was arrested and is currently detained at Chikurubi Maximum Prison fears for his life after the the Officer in Charge of the prison told Job that “he shall die in prison.”
This was according to Sikhala’s lawyers yesterday as they were presenting a case against the arrest of the top opposition official.
Sikhala’s lawyer, Harrison Nkomo told Harare Magistrate, Lanzini Ncube that he was advised that the accused wanted to be President of the country which was undesirable and that he shall die in prison hence must provide mobile number for next of kin.
The Zengeza West MP’s lawyers argued that his alleged statements/utterances do not amount to inciting people to commit public violence but he was exercising his constitutionally guaranteed rights.
George Mutimbanyoka, the Officer in Charge at Chikurubi Maximum Prison allegedly ordered a junior officer to handcuff Sikhala the whole day and to keep him with leg irons.
Sikhala’s lawyers also raised concern about the health threats posed to their client as he was not provided with any PPE despite that he had been informed by other inmates that several inmates had tested for Covid-19 in the same section he is being detained.
Magistrate Ncube ordered that the cells be immediately sanitised in the interest of the inmates.
Several supporters of the vocal legislator protested at the Magistrate court.
Magistrate Ncube is hearing arguments which will continue on Tuesday. More to follow…
